Hyundai Motor logs strong sales in Australia

By Yonhap

Published : Nov. 13, 2017 - 09:49

    • Link copied

Hyundai Motor Co. has posted strong sales in Australia this year thanks to the popularity of its new i30 hatchback and other models, industry data showed Monday.

Hyundai Motor, South Korea's leading automaker, sold 3,983 new i30 hatchbacks in the Australian market last month, making the car the best-selling model, according to the data.

The figure represents a 46.5 percent jump from 2,718 sales of the old version sold in Australia during the same month a year earlier.

A Hyundai Motor official attributed the new i30 hatchback's robust sales in Australia to its high brand recognition among motorists there and the company's active promotional activities.

"The new i30 is Hyundai's most popular model in Australia," he said. "It won the monthly best-selling car title, more than a year after the old i30 became the top-selling car in the first half of 2016."

Hyundai launched the new i30 hatchback in Australia in March this year. In the January-October period, the model's combined sales there ranked fifth after the Toyota Hilux, the Ford Ranger, the Toyota Corolla and the Mazda 3.

On top of the new i30, Hyundai's Kona subcompact SUV registered strong sales in Australia in October. Only 71 Konas were sold in September, the month it debuted in Australia, but the figure soared to 857 units last month.

Backed by strong sales of the new i30, the Kona and other models, Hyundai's cumulative sales in Australia came third, trailing Toyota and Mazda of Japan. (Yonhap)
